16.5.2 In-band events from DCE to DTE

The following <dle> shielded codes (refer PN-3131 sections 5.2 and 7.3) can be sent by
DCE when in class 8 mode (+FCLASS=8). At least some of these events are required if
binary voice data is transferred through the AT command interface. Other events of PN-3131
are not applicable to GSM. See also +VLS command.
